Suicide bomber dies while trying to bomb primary school in Ebonyi (Video)

A suspected suicide bomber has blown himself to death when his suicide strap exploded on his body on Tuesday in Afikpo town, Afikpo local government area of Ebonyi state.

It was gathered that the incident occurred at about 12:00 pm while he was entering Amaizu/ Amangballa Primary School.

Standard Observers reports that he was turned back by a security guard in the school security after he failed to explain the reason for his visit but all of a sudden began running inside a nearby bush where the said bomb exploded.

The explosion forced residents to scamper for safety. The incident later attracted buyers and sellers from the nearby Eke Afikpo Market.

The police could not be reached for comments at the time of filing this report.
